About 2-(2,2-dimethylpropylamino)acetyl chloride
2-(2,2-dimethylpropylamino)acetyl chloride (PubChem CID 175069238) has the molecular formula C7H14ClNO
and a molecular weight of 163.65 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-(2,2-dimethylpropylamino)acetyl chloride.
